    Question Local/Global Positioning 13L Arrivals at JFK ?

    Listening to the JFK ATIS on Fri. afternoon, Aug. 30. I heard an expression I haven't heard before. Some aircraft could expect "Local (Global) Positioning to Rwy 13L". The voice said either local or global, very hard to understand. In any case, I was surprised that any aircraft would be vectored for VOR 13L at JFK with a low ceiling partially blocking the lead-in lights. Why were 13L approaches in use and what is local or global positioning? It must involve GPS. Thanks for any explanation.
